Abstract
An A/D converter converts a composite video signal to a digital signal. A bandpass filter extracts a chroma signal-A sinX from the composite video signal in digital form. A delay circuit delays the chroma signal-A sinX by 1/4 fsc to output-A cosX. Delay circuits delay the chroma signal-A sinX by 1/2 fsc to output A sinX. A ROM stores values of -(1 - cos.theta.) and sin.theta.. Values of -(1 - cos.theta.) and sin.theta. are read from the ROM in accordance with a phase modulation amount .theta. of a voltage controlled oscillator. A multiplier multiplies a value of sin.theta. read from the ROM and A cosX output from the delay circuit. A multiplier multiplies a value of -(1 - cos.theta.) read from the ROM and A sinX output from the delay circuit. An adder adds outputs of the multipliers. Delay circuits delays the composite video signal output from the A/D converter. An adder adds an output of the adder and the composite video signal output from the delay circuit.
